Tales of the Shire: Is There Romance?

Tales of the Shire does not include any romance options. The game focuses on friendships, community building, and Hobbit-style companionship rather than romantic relationships.

Why Tales of the Shire Has No Romance

The developers confirmed that romance was never planned for this game. Their goal was to create a warm and cozy experience that stays true to Hobbit culture and the tone of the Shire.

Instead of dating mechanics, the game encourages strong bonds through shared meals, gardening clubs, fishing, and crafting activities. These interactions focus on friendship and neighborly goodwill, keeping the world lighthearted and family-friendly.

What to Expect Instead of Romance

Without romance systems, Tales of the Shire leans heavily into social tasks and cooperative gameplay. Building relationships with fellow Hobbits unlocks special dialogue, shared meals, and small community events.

Players can grow friendships through gift-giving, completing tasks, and hosting gatherings. These features replace the need for romantic storylines while still giving the game a sense of connection and personal interaction.
